I was gifted an old water table that had significant water damage. I had a lot of fun stripping, repairing, and restoring it. This was my first furniture restoration, and I learned a lot about how to treat wood... and a few things not to do.
I tried baking soda, hydrogen peroxide, and even toothpaste to lift the water stains out. It wasn't until I used some Barkeeper's Friend (and some elbow grease) that I finally got some results. I'm quite pleased with the final results, and I hope you have fun watching it come together.
